StarkWare has announced the launch of its 'Private KYC' solution, aiming to enhance user privacy in the crypto sector. This new initiative seeks to redefine how identity checks are conducted, addressing the vulnerabilities of personal data exposure.

The solution specifically targets the issue where current KYC processes require full documents when only a single piece of information is necessary. This approach helps prevent unnecessary data exposure, an ongoing concern for crypto users and platforms.

Technical details highlight the use of Starknet's zk-rollup technology. This enables proof without exposing all data, maintaining both efficiency and security. Traders could see a reduction in the overhead associated with traditional KYC procedures, potentially improving transaction speeds.

For active traders, the introduction of 'Private KYC' means less friction during identity verification, while maintaining compliance with regulatory demands. The streamlined process is expected to facilitate faster onboarding and lower the risks associated with data breaches.

The release comes as regulatory environments globally are tightening. As governments push for rigorous KYC standards, solutions like StarkWare's could bridge the gap between compliance and privacy.

However, while promising, 'Private KYC' still faces challenges in widespread adoption. Traders and platforms must evaluate its integration into existing systems, considering any compatibility issues or initial setup hurdles.
